Description |
Recent research focus is on converting vibration to useful energy. The vibration energy from automobiles, electrical motors, and aircraft structures can be used for low power applications by energy harvesting. Piezoelectric energy harvesting is the most efficient method for this purpose. In this paper experiments are carried out using Polyvinylidene difluoride (PVDF) film which is a piezoelectric material for comparative study. Three different dimensional PVDF film with same input conditions are experimented and their output voltage generated are compared
